Hiring a regular tow truck without a buyer attached usually costs $75-$200 for a short local move, more if you need flatbed service or after-hours pickup. Storage fees at tow yards add another $35-$50/day. When all you need is the vehicle gone, paying out of pocket to tow it makes no sense.

There's a real difference between a local Charlotte junk car buyer and a national online vehicle buying service. National services route every call through a centralized dispatcher, then assign your pickup to a contracted local hauler — usually a tow company that gets paid a flat fee regardless of what your vehicle is actually worth. The national service marks up the spread between what you're paid and what the local hauler delivers, and the result is consistently lower offers and slower pickups.
